Torque is often treated like a fixed number. It is not.

A bolt does not “know” the torque value printed on a chart. It reacts to thread condition, surface finish, lubrication, washer face, material strength, and joint stiffness. Two bolts with the same size and grade can produce very different clamp loads at the same torque.

For buyers, the safe question is not “What torque should I use?” The better question is “What information is needed before a torque value can be selected?”

Torque Is a Method, Not the Goal

The goal of tightening is preload, or clamp force. Torque is only one method used to reach it.

A large part of applied torque is lost to friction under the head, under the nut, and in the threads. Only a smaller portion becomes useful bolt tension. This is why dry, zinc plated, hot-dip galvanized, oiled, waxed, or coated bolts cannot be treated the same.

When sourcing prodotti di fissaggio, buyers should confirm the installation condition before asking the supplier or engineer to recommend torque.

Information Buyers Must Confirm First

Informazioni richiestePerché è importante
Dimensioni del bullone e passo della filettaturaDetermines stress area and thread behavior
Grado di resistenza o classe di proprietàSets the safe preload range
MaterialeCarbon steel, alloy steel, and stainless steel behave differently
Finitura superficialeChanges friction and torque-tension relationship
Condizione di lubrificazioneDry and lubricated torque values may differ greatly
Nut or tapped hole materialControls thread stripping risk
Utilizzo della lavatriceAffects bearing surface and friction
Materiale congiuntoSoft materials compress and relax more
Tipo di caricoStatic, vibration, impact, and fatigue need different control
Governing standardDefines testing, marking, and mechanical requirements

For metric projects, the Guida agli standard di fissaggio DIN e ISO can help buyers align bolt class, thread dimensions, and related specifications.

Material and Grade Come First

Carbon Steel and Alloy Steel Bolts

Carbon steel and alloy steel bolts are common in machinery, structural steel, equipment frames, and general industrial assemblies. Grade 8.8, 10.9, 12.9, SAE Grade 5, and SAE Grade 8 bolts are not interchangeable just because the diameter is the same.

Higher strength can support higher preload, but only if the mating nut, washer, joint material, and installation method are suitable.

Buyers reviewing elementi di fissaggio in acciaio al carbonio should confirm the full property class or grade, not only the material name.

Stainless Steel Bolts

Stainless steel bolts need special care. They can gall during tightening, especially without lubrication. A torque value that works well for alloy steel may damage stainless threads.

For stainless assemblies, confirm:

  • Stainless grade, such as 304, 316, A2-70, or A4-80
  • Requisiti di lubrificazione o antigrippaggio
  • Adattamento del filo
  • Mating nut material
  • Velocità di installazione

Surface Finish Changes Torque Behavior

Surface finish is one of the most common causes of torque mistakes.

Zinc plated bolts may tighten differently from black oxide bolts. Hot-dip galvanized bolts have thicker coating and often require compatible tapped nuts. Dacromet-type coatings and waxed finishes may reduce friction.

Per elementi di fissaggio rivestiti, buyers should ask whether torque values are based on dry, oiled, waxed, or as-supplied condition.

Do not mix finishes in the same torque-controlled assembly unless engineering has approved it.

Joint Design Must Be Known

A torque setting cannot be selected from the bolt alone.

The joint may include steel plates, castings, aluminum parts, rubber gaskets, painted surfaces, washers, slots, or soft spacers. These details affect clamp retention.

Problemi comuni sul campo

  • Bolt reaches torque but the joint is not clamped.
  • Washer embeds into soft material.
  • Nut strips before target preload.
  • Coating friction causes false high torque.
  • Lubricated bolts are over-tightened using dry torque values.
  • Reused fasteners produce inconsistent results.

These are not supplier catalog problems. They are installation-control problems.

Standards and Test Method

Torque guidance may be linked to project standards, customer drawings, or field procedures. Structural bolting may follow different practices from machinery assembly. Some joints require turn-of-nut, tension control bolts, direct tension indicators, or calibrated wrench methods instead of simple torque tightening.

Buyers ordering elementi di fissaggio standard should confirm whether the order requires mechanical test reports, proof load data, coating reports, or torque-tension testing.

RFQ Checklist for Torque-Controlled Orders

Includere questi dettagli nella richiesta di offerta:

  1. Bolt standard, size, pitch, length, and grade.
  2. Nut grade and washer standard.
  3. Finitura superficiale e condizioni di lubrificazione.
  4. Joint material and washer bearing surface.
  5. Required preload or installation torque, if already defined.
  6. Relevant standard, drawing, or project specification.
  7. Whether torque-tension testing is required.
  8. Packing method to prevent oil loss, rust, or coating damage.

Consigli pratici per l'acquisto

Do not ask for a universal torque chart and treat it as final approval. Use charts only as starting references. Final torque should come from engineering review, standard requirements, or torque-tension testing under the real assembly condition.

For critical joints, confirm the fastener set as an assembly: bolt, nut, washer, coating, lubrication, and installation method.
